Knit for a Cause: Fun Ways to Fundraise with Your Knitting Needles!
Love to knit? Got more yarn than you know what to do with? Good news – your hobby can do more than just keep you (and your teapot) warm… it can help raise money for charity too! Whether you’re a beginner or a seasoned stitcher, here are some fun and easy ways to turn your knitting into a force for good.
1. Knit & Sell
One of the simplest ways to fundraise is by selling your makes – think scarves, hats, baby booties, or cute little animals. You can:
- Set up a stall at a local craft fair or market
- Pop them on Etsy or Facebook Marketplace
- Offer them to friends and family for a suggested donation
People love a handmade item, especially when they know the money’s going to a good cause!
2. Get Stitching Together
Start a “knit & natter” group and fundraise as a team. You could:
- Collect a small donation each session
- Work together on items to sell or raffle
- Make it a sponsored knitting challenge!
It’s social, it’s soothing, and you’re doing good. Win-win-win.
3. Take on a Knitting Challenge
Why not get sponsored to:
- Knit a blanket in a week
- Make 100 tiny teddies
- Teach someone to knit in exchange for a donation?
Set yourself a fun or slightly bonkers knitting goal and ask friends, family or social media followers to support you.
4. Craft for a Cause
Knit things that people really want:
- Christmas decorations
- Easter chicks with creme eggs inside (yes, please)
- Poppies for Remembrance Day
- Woolly pumpkins in autumn
- Cosy hats, scarves and gloves for wintry weather
These seasonal makes are always popular and perfect for selling to raise funds.
